Overview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up
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up, an antibiotic medication, effectively combats various bacterial infections in children. Its applications span ear, eye, nose, throat, lung, skin, digestive, and urinary tract infections. It's also indicated for uncomplicated typhoid fever in children and adolescents. For optimal absorption, administer this syrup one hour before or two hours after meals; however, if stomach upset occurs, administer it with food. Dosage and treatment length are determined by infection severity and type; strictly adhere to your doctor's instructions. If vomiting occurs within 30 minutes of intake, repeat the dose; avoid doubling if it's near the next scheduled dose. Avoid use for common colds and flu, as these are typically viral and antibiotics are ineffective. Prescription for these symptoms only occurs if a secondary bacterial infection is identified. Minor, transient side effects like vomiting, diarrhea, nausea, stomach pain, gas, and allergic reactions may occur, typically resolving as the body adjusts. Persistent or severe side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Complete disclosure of your child's medical history, including allergies, heart conditions, blood disorders, congenital defects, breathing problems, lung issues, digestive problems, skin conditions, liver or kidney dysfunction, is crucial for safe and effective treatment.

How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up works:
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up, an antibiotic medication, inhibits bacterial growth by disrupting cell wall synthesis. This crucial bacterial structure is necessary for survival; its disruption halts bacterial proliferation and infection spread, while mitigating the risk of antibiotic resistance development.
SAFETY ADVICE
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up can be administered to patients with liver disease without altering the dosage. Nevertheless, parental consultation with a pediatrician is advisable prior to administering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up to children exhibiting severe hepatic impairment.
What if you forget to take Tefloc 50mg Dry Syrup :
If your pediatrician hasn't prescribed an alternative schedule, administer the missed dose upon recollection. Omit the missed dose if the next scheduled dose is imminent. Avoid doubling the dose to compensate; adhere to the recommended dosage instructions.
